This journal publishes research on the dynamics of intimate relationships and their impact on individual and relational well-being, with a focus on various psychological and health-related outcomes. Articles explore topics such as PTSD, breast cancer treatment, opioid use disorder, family conflict, caregiving, sexual satisfaction, coparenting, and substance use within couples and families.
